The effect of spin polarization on the ground state of Kondo type system is a fundamental issue in study of Anderson model. By using variational and diagonal methods we analysis the stability of Kondo singlet state in s-d model and Zhang-Rice singlet state in two-component model for high Tc superconductivity when Cu site spin polarization is considered.
